4.13 O2 Flush Valve
The O
2
flush valve is located at the front of the machine next to the freshgas
outlet. Access to the flush valve requires removal of the table top. Figure 4-13
shows the mounting and assembly details of the flush valve.
4.13.1 Set the System Power switch to STANDBY.
4.13.2 Disconnect all pipeline hoses.
4.13.3 Close the O
2
cylinder valve.
4.13.4 Press the O
2
Flush valve to drain oxygen pressure from the system.
4.13.5 Remove the screws holding the table top to the machine and lift out
the table top.
4.13.6 Hold the O
2
Flush button in and rotate it until one of its set screws
are visible through the access hole in the guard ring, and loosen the
set screw.
4.13.7 Turn the O
2
Flush button 180 degrees, hold it in and loosen the other
set screw.
4.13.8 Remove the O
2
Flush button and washer from the valve shaft.
4.13.9 Disconnect the two compression fittings at the valve.
NOTE: Do not lose the flow restrictor located at the right-angle
fitting. This restrictor will be transferred to the
replacement valve assembly.
4.13.10 The O
2
Flush valve is retained by the guard ring on the front of the
machine frame. Hold the body of the Clippard valve with an open end
wrench; insert a rod or hex wrench through the holes in the guard
ring (or use a spanner wrench), and un-screw the guard ring from the
front of the frame rail.
4.13.11 Assemble the replacement O
2
Flush valve, spacer, internal tooth lock
washer and guard ring through the frame and tighten the assembly,
making sure that the valve is mounted straight.
